Nandapur Population - Ganjam, Orissa
Nandapur is a small village located in BADAGADA Block of Ganjam district, Orissa with total 12 families residing. The Nandapur village has population of 59 of which 30 are males while 29 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Nandap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 8 which makes up 13.56 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Nandapur village is 967 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Nandapur as per census is 600, lower than Orissa average of 941.
Nandapur village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Nandapur village was 50.98 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Nandapur Male literacy stands at 68.00 % while female literacy rate was 34.62 %.

Nandapur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 12 | - | - |
Population | 59 | 30 | 29 |
Child (0-6) | 8 | 5 | 3 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 58 | 29 | 29 |
Literacy | 50.98 % | 68.00 % | 34.62 % |
Total Workers | 33 | 16 | 17 |
Main Worker | 18 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 15 | 4 | 11 |
